Harley Dean was born in Columbus, Ohio, and entered the adult industry in January 2014 at age 20. In the years since, she's built a genuinely deep studio résumé — BangBros, Mofos, Reality Kings, Naughty America, Devil's Film, Diabolic, Digital Desire, New Sensations, Evasive Angles, Jules Jordan Video, and West Coast Productions among the recurring names, with premium-tier credits at Vixen, Deeper, and Evil Angel.
2021 was a notable pivot point: she landed a run with Playboy Plus, including a Playboy All Star of the Month feature in March of that year, which pushed her into more glamour-leaning territory alongside the hardcore studio work. That range — mainstream studio scenes plus a Playboy chapter — is unusual longevity for a performer who's been active over a decade, and it's the main reason she still shows up in "who's worth following" conversations rather than fading into the long tail.
She's also had a direct-to-fan presence going back to November 2017, meaning her paid channel isn't a recent pivot — it's been running in parallel with her studio career for years.
